First Offense DUI Charges in New Jersey
What Is a First Offense DUI?
Under N.J.S.A. 39:4-50, a person may be charged with DUI if they operate a motor vehicle with a blood alcohol concentration of 0.08 percent or higher, or while under the influence of drugs or alcohol.

Penalties for First Offense DUI in New Jersey
A first offense DUI conviction may result in:
- License suspension for three months to one year
- Fines and surcharges up to several thousand dollars
- Ignition interlock device requirement
- Mandatory alcohol education classes
- Up to 30 days in jail in certain cases
- A permanent DUI record
Second and Third Offense DUI Charges in New Jersey
What Makes Repeat Offenses More Serious?
A second or third DUI offense carries dramatically enhanced penalties. Prosecutors treat repeat offenders with heightened scrutiny, and judges have less flexibility to offer alternatives.
Penalties for Second Offense DUI
A second DUI conviction may result in:
- License suspension of two years
- Mandatory ignition interlock device
- Substantially higher fines and surcharges
- Mandatory jail time of 48 hours to 90 days
- Required alcohol evaluation and treatment
- Extended community service
Penalties for Third Offense DUI
A third DUI conviction is among the most serious non felony traffic offenses in New Jersey, leading to:
- License suspension of ten years
- Mandatory jail time of 180 days
- Ignition interlock device requirement
- Significant fines approaching ten thousand dollars
- Permanent impact on driving privileges
Breath Test Refusal Charges in New Jersey
What Is a DUI Refusal Charge?
Under New Jersey’s implied consent law, all drivers are deemed to have consented to chemical testing. Refusing to provide a breath sample triggers a separate charge under N.J.S.A. 39:4-50.2.
The penalties for a first time refusal include:
- License suspension for seven months to one year
- Fines and insurance surcharges
- Ignition interlock requirement
- Mandatory alcohol education

Drug Related DUI Charges in New Jersey
DUI charges are not limited to alcohol. You can be charged with driving under the influence of:
- 🌿 Marijuana or cannabis
- 💊 Prescription medication that impairs driving
- ❄️ Illegal drugs such as cocaine or opioids
- 🧪 MDMA or ecstasy
- 💉 Heroin or other controlled substances
Law enforcement officers rely on drug recognition experts to assess impairment. These evaluations can be challenged based on medical conditions, fatigue, or improper administration.
Underage DUI Charges in New Jersey
New Jersey enforces a zero tolerance policy for drivers under 21. A blood alcohol concentration of 0.01 percent or higher can result in:
- License suspension for 30 to 90 days
- Mandatory alcohol education program
- Community service requirements
- Fines and court costs
- Possible ignition interlock requirements
An underage DUI does not always lead to the same severe penalties as an adult DUI, but the consequences can still affect college admissions, financial aid, and employment opportunities.
Defenses to DUI Charges in New Jersey
Every DUI case is unique. A strong defense strategy depends on the facts, police conduct, testing procedures, and available evidence.
Potential defenses may include:
- 🛡️ Unlawful Traffic Stop The officer lacked reasonable suspicion to pull you over.
- 📋 Improper Field Sobriety Testing Tests were not administered according to standardized procedures.
- 🔬 Inaccurate Breathalyzer Results The device was not properly calibrated or maintained.
- 💊 Medical Conditions Conditions like acid reflux, diabetes, or neurological disorders can mimic impairment or affect breath test results.
- ⏱️ Rising Blood Alcohol Defense Your BAC may have been below the legal limit while driving but rose by the time of testing.
- 🗣️ Lack of Observable Impairment The officer’s observations do not support a DUI charge.
- ⚖️ Constitutional Violations Illegal search or seizure may exclude evidence.
